Output d50e819ecd8d2b8e45a4b0ccd4fc72a795ca581cb06bc6fb29351483817fef99:11

value
2344990
script pubkey
OP_0 OP_PUSHBYTES_20 ac45594836032037738bac2567cb901deb146eb7
address
bc1q43z4jjpkqvsrwuut4sjk0jusrh43gm4hqwhtqj
transaction
d50e819ecd8d2b8e45a4b0ccd4fc72a795ca581cb06bc6fb29351483817fef99
confirmations
247339
spent
true